List of Nicole Krauss Quotes

One is always changing. i don't want to write the same book and i couldn't, because i'm a different person.
The unique thing that literature provides is to be able to step so fully into another situation and condition.
For me, the most powerful way to write about something is through the absence of it. rather than writing about what it was to become a new mother, i wrote, for example, a father facing death and addressing his estranged son about the regrets of his relationship.
Life in general in my experience gets deeper and deeper, more and more profound, more and more complex, the older one gets.
In one's youth, one has tremendous access to one's feelings. and as one gets older, some of those feelings kind of drift away. but so much more happens to you. there's more at stake in life.
When you're younger, it's all theoretical. it's all potential. as you get older, it becomes actual, and your life gets filled with unexpected complexity; some of it asked for, and some of it not. it becomes richer, i find.
What interests me very much as a writer is the ability for writing to have our lives to be occupied so vividly by others. i think that's what we long for as writers.
Part of the work of writing a novel is to uncover the symmetries or connections that make it whole, which might not reveal itself at first.
I have a very strong sense of architecture in my novels. but at first it's sometimes like building a doorknob before you have a door, and a door before you have a room.
I do realize that the reader needs some form of resolution. sometimes i think of it almost like writing a musical score where things have to harmonize and certain lines have to come to a close.
Why are we so addicted to factual knowledge? why are we so uncomfortable with the unknown? is it something about the anxiety of our time? because of course that wasn't always the way. even now the whole idea of the rational individual has been subject to question and yet we still cling to this idea of factual, rational knowledge being more valuable than whatever its opposite might be.
You're looking for ways always as the writer to bring readers into intimacy, you with them with you. photos can sometimes do the opposite, create distance and perspective, but these somehow didn't. they somehow bring the reader closer.
